Tell me about a time when you consulted with a patient to understand their aesthetic goals and provided professional advice.
Sample answer to the question:
In my previous position as an Aesthetic Medicine Physician, I had a patient who came to me wanting to improve the appearance of their skin due to acne scarring. During the consultation, I took the time to listen to their concerns and understand their aesthetic goals. I explained the available treatment options and recommended a combination of laser resurfacing and chemical peels to address their specific needs. I discussed the benefits, risks, and expected outcomes of each procedure, ensuring they had all the information needed to make an informed decision. Throughout the process, I provided continuous support and guidance, answering any questions they had. The patient was very satisfied with the results, and their self-confidence improved significantly.

An example of a exceptional answer:
Let me share a remarkable experience during my role as an Aesthetic Medicine Physician where I had the opportunity to consult with a patient seeking to enhance their appearance for a special event. This patient expressed concerns about the appearance of their skin, including fine lines, uneven texture, and pigmentation issues. To gain a comprehensive understanding of their aesthetic goals, I conducted a thorough assessment of their skin and personal history. Demonstrating my expertise in non-surgical cosmetic treatments, I recommended a multi-modal approach, combining Botox injections to soften dynamic wrinkles, dermal fillers to restore facial volume, and a series of fractional laser treatments to address their specific skin concerns. Understanding the sensitivity of the situation, I adopted a compassionate and empathetic approach, ensuring the patient felt heard and valued throughout the process. I provided detailed explanations of each procedure, including potential risks and expected outcomes, to empower the patient to make informed decisions. Additionally, I provided pre-treatment and post-treatment care instructions, ensuring optimal results and the patient's comfort. By coordinating the treatment schedule efficiently and working closely with my team, I ensured seamless patient management and minimized wait times. The patient was incredibly satisfied with the outcome, reporting improved self-confidence and feeling radiant for their special event.

How to prepare for this question:
  • Familiarize yourself with the latest advancements in non-surgical cosmetic treatments and technologies to demonstrate your expertise during the consultation.
  • Practice active listening and empathetic communication techniques to ensure you understand the patient's concerns and goals.
  • Prepare examples of past experiences where you provided professional advice to patients and achieved high patient satisfaction.
  • Highlight your ability to handle sensitive issues with discretion and empathy by sharing instances where you maintained patient confidentiality and built trust.
  • Emphasize your commitment to patient care and service orientation by discussing your approach to personalized treatment plans and ongoing support throughout the treatment process.
  • Demonstrate your organizational and time management skills by sharing strategies you use to efficiently manage patient appointments and minimize wait times.
What are interviewers evaluating with this question?
  • Expertise in non-surgical cosmetic treatments and technologies.
  • Strong diagnostic and decision-making skills.
  • Ability to handle sensitive issues with discretion and empathy.
  • Outstanding patient care and service orientation.
  • Excellent organizational and time management skills.
